60 Million Apps Sold at iTunes Store, There is a Kill Switch, Says Steve Jobs

It's been a month since the iTunes App Store went live, and in an interview with the Wall St Journal, Steve Jobs has put the apps downloads figure at over 60 million. With the mix of free and paid apps, that brought Apple around $30 million. That's obviously encouraged Steve: he's enthusiastic that maybe "it will be a $1 billion marketplace at some point in time" adding that he's "never seen anything like this in my career for software." And in a slightly unusual candid comment, for Steve anyway, he's admitted that the apps won't be making Apple much profit—instead future sales hopes are pinned on the applications tempting people to buy more iPhones and iPod touches.

Best Buy to Sell Ubuntu with 60 Days of Support

Ubuntu is a popular Linux distro that has been available as a free download since in initial release back in 2004. However, there are some obstacles that stand in the way of adoption but the non-technical out there not the least of which is the need for a high-speed connection for the download and the tools needed to burn an ISO image (right -What's an ISO image?). In an effort to expand its reach beyond enthusiasts and the more technical savvy, Canonical Ltd. is partnering with Best Buy stores to offer a boxed set of the software for $19.99US. What the retail version gets you, besides the install discs, is a quick install guide along with 60 days of free support. The boxed sets are produced by ValuSoft which will also provide the support with backup help from Canonical for any issues its support staff can't handle.

There's a Sucker Converted Every Minute

Ponca City, We love you writes "Once the US converts from analog to digital broadcasting next February, those who receive their signals over the air will need a converter box for older, non-digital models. Government-approved converter boxes sell for $60 or less and a government-issued $40 rebate coupon is available for the asking but that hasn't stopped companies like the Ohio-based Universal TechTronics from offering supposedly free converter boxes. The gimmick: the box is free, as long as you pay $88 for a five-year warranty, plus $9.30 shipping. Universal TechTronics seems to specialize in 'high-tech' products of questionable value, marketing the Cool Surge portable air cooler, 'a work of engineering genius from the China coast so advanced that no windows, vents, or freon are needed' that uses the same energy as a 60-watt light bulb.
